I decided to take the Opteka 500mm mirror lens along with me today and took some shots. Note all the photos have been digitally enhanced, cropped and resized for web viewing.

As suggested in my previous post, this lens works best when taken with high shutter speeds. Try not to get +0.0 exposure on your camera or you’ll get overexposed photos. The photos will look pale, but some post-processing with Photoshop should fix them.

Verdict? The Opteka 500mm mirror lens is a good toy for some fun. The photos are decent enough for some web photos, but one should not consider it for professional use.

Enjoy the pics! Photos taken with an Olympus E-420 and Opteka 500mm mirror @ f/8.0. No tripods used.
